1 JounQin 2022-07-20 08:29:54 +08:00 via iPhone |
![]() | 2 freetes 2022-07-20 08:29:59 +08:00 可以通过 2 次 commit 来做:第 1 次删除掉之前的文件,第 2 次新增改完名字后的文件 |
![]() | 3 coolair 2022-07-20 08:30:29 +08:00 git config core.ignorecase false 然后,直接删了远程仓库,重推一遍。 |
![]() | 4 xaplux 2022-07-20 08:32:02 +08:00 git config --get core.ignorecase 查看,true 代表默认是不区分大小写的 git config core.ignorecase false 设置区分大小写,改回 push 上去 |
5 JounQin 2022-07-20 08:32:06 +08:00 via iPhone 把配置保存到 .gitattributes 文件就行了,不用那么复杂 |
6 zhuweiyou 2022-07-20 08:50:34 +08:00 知道哪些文件的话 git mv a b 就行了, 如果实在太多了, 删了远程分支重新推 |
8 leonard916 2022-07-20 11:58:21 +08:00 建议同事换 Linux ,或者找老板要台 Mac ( Win 的锅 ( doge |
![]() | 9 damngoto 2022-07-20 12:24:11 +08:00 via Android 我当时也被折腾了好久, |
![]() | 10 unt OP @leonard916 Mac 也大小写不敏感 |
![]() | 12 imxieke 2022-07-20 17:08:30 +08:00 @leonard916 #8 macOS 也是哈哈哈 踩过坑 |
13 leonard916 2022-07-30 22:20:37 +08:00 @unt 可以改 |
14 leonard916 2022-07-30 22:20:56 +08:00 @imxieke 默认确实不分,但可以改 |